首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
前端
订阅
小米西果
更多收藏集
微信扫码分享
微信
新浪微博
QQ
7篇文章 · 0订阅
介绍下 Set、Map、WeakSet 和 WeakMap 的区别?
题目描述:介绍下Set、Map、WeakSet和WeakMap的区别?解题:思路一:Set和Map主要的应用场景在于数据重组和数据储存Set是一种叫做集合的数据结构,Map是一种叫做字典的数据结构1.
看动画轻松理解「递归」与「动态规划」
在学习「数据结构和算法」的过程中,因为人习惯了平铺直叙的思维方式,所以「递归」与「动态规划」这种带循环概念(绕来绕去)的往往是相对比较难以理解的两个抽象知识点。 程序员小吴打算使用动画的形式来帮助理解「递归」,然后通过「递归」的概念延伸至理解「动态规划」算法思想。 先下定义:递…
Lodash中的cloneDeep
在ECMAScript 中我们常说的拷贝分两种:深拷贝和浅拷贝,也有分为值拷贝和引用拷贝。深拷贝、浅拷贝的区分点就是对引用类型的对象进行不同的操作,前者拷贝引用类型执行的实际值(值拷贝),后者只拷贝引用(引用拷贝)。浅拷贝基本上也无需多复杂的实现,语言本身提供的 Object.…
JavaScript原型链与继承
1. 原型链 基本思想:利用原型让一个引用类型继承另一个引用类型的属性和方法。 原型对象:每个构造函数在创建时都会有一个prototype属性指向这个函数的原型对象,而原型对象会获得一个constructor属性指向构造函数。当调用构造函数创建实例后,实例都包含一个指向构造函数…
前端看源码,就从axios开始吧
前端要看源码,就从axios开始吧,因为它的逻辑不仅没有很复杂,而且设计也很巧妙。打包后只有一千六百多行,挑三拣四,走马观花,去掉注释后,就更没多少了。 来句官方的话:Axios 是一个基于 promise 的 HTTP 库,可以用在浏览器和 node.js 中。 通过了解ax…
正则表达式不要背
正则表达式一直是困扰很多程序员的一门技术,当然也包括曾经的我。大多数时候我们在开发过程中要用到某些正则表达式的时候,都会打开谷歌或百度直接搜索然后拷贝粘贴。当下一次再遇到相同问题的时候,同样的场景又再来一遍。作为一门用途很广的技术,我相信深入理解正则表达式并能融会贯通是值得的。…
es6新增数组方法简便了哪些操作?
在这里不过多阐述,我也是跟着阮一峰大佬的《es6入门》来学习的,es6新增了很多的方法、属性,让我们在编码中得到了很高的提升,在这里只对array这块进行阐述,其他的就过不多介绍了。 是不是及其简单!其中 new Set()会把重复的数据过滤到,得到一个类数组的对象,Array…